Andrew Perrott Loaned to Stingrays
April 17, 2025
The Hershey Bears announced that the club has loaned defenseman Andrew Perrott to the ECHL's South Carolina Stingrays.
Perrott, 23, skated in 19 games with Hershey this season, scoring four points (1g, 3a). He logged six fighting majors, 42 penalty minutes, and a +9 rating.
With the Stingrays, Perrott played in 43 games, posting 21 points (7g, 14a) and 98 penalty minutes. He rejoins South Carolina ahead of the club's first playoff game on Friday versus the Orlando Solar Bears.
